Cardiologists manage a wide array of conditions. Some of the most frequent include:
This problem involves the narrowing or blockage of the arteries supplying blood to the heart muscle, often due to plaque buildup. In real-world terms, it can lead to chest pain (angina) or heart attacks. Effective management focuses on lifestyle changes, medications, and sometimes procedures like angioplasty.
Heart failure occurs when the heart cannot pump blood efficiently. It doesn't mean the heart has stopped, but rather that itβs weakened. Symptoms can include shortness of breath and fatigue. approach aims to improve the heart's pumping ability and manage fluid buildup.
These are irregular heartbeats, which can manifest as a heart beating too fast, too slow, or erratically. Atrial fibrillation (AFib) is a frequent type. Specialists may use medications or procedures like ablation to restore a normal heart rhythm.

Chronically elevated blood pressure puts considerable strain on the heart and blood vessels. While often asymptomatic, it's a major danger factor for heart attack, stroke, and kidney disease. Regular monitoring and appropriate therapy are crucial.
Problems with the heart valves can disrupt blood flow. This can range from mild leakage to severe narrowing. Depending on the severity, intervention may involve medication or valve repair/replacement surgery.

Early indicators of heart issues can include chest discomfort or pain, shortness of breath, irregular heartbeats, unusual fatigue, and swelling in the legs or ankles. Experiencing any of these signs warrants a consultation with a healthcare professional.
For individuals with no diagnosed heart conditions or marked chance factors, regular check-ups with a general physician are usually sufficient. However, if you have possibility factors like diabetes, high blood pressure, high cholesterol, or a family history of heart disease, your doctor might recommend periodic visits to a cardiologist starting in middle age.
While weight loss is not their primary specialty, cardiologists often play a crucial role in guiding sufferers towards healthier weights as part of a heart-healthy lifestyle. They can advise on dietary changes and exercise regimens that benefit cardiovascular health, often collaborating with dietitians or bariatric specialists for comprehensive plans.
A cardiologist is a physician who diagnoses and treats heart conditions primarily through medication, lifestyle changes, and non-surgical procedures like angioplasty. A cardiac surgeon, on the other hand, is a surgeon who performs operations on the heart and major blood vessels, such as bypass surgery or valve replacements.
